MEMO — Warranty-Cost Overrun, Delvane Series

To all sales leads: warranty claims on the Delvane appliance series have exceeded budget by 18 percent this quarter, traced largely to a gasket fault in early production lots. A revised component enters assembly next month, and affected stock is being flagged. Please moderate extended-warranty pitches until then. The confidential note on business plans is appended below.

board note of bajop-yaweg: The western region missed its Pelys quota by 58.0 percent last quarter. Pelysek Foods plans to raise the Belius list price by 44.0 percent in July. The steering committee signed off on a budget of $133.8 million for Project Pelax. The renewal with Zoraelix Systems closes at $61.9 million a year, 12.7 percent above the last contract.

Handover: Exportron retry queue

Hi Mira — handing over the failed-export retries. Exports that hit a timeout land in the retry queue and get three attempts with backoff; after that they're parked and need a manual requeue from the admin panel. Watch for customers reporting duplicates — that usually means a double requeue. The current retry settings are as follows.

settings of bajog-fawig:
oliael:
  log_level: warn
  metrics_host: metrics.oliael.zemvarsys.internal
  pin: 0267
  pool_size: 32

Quarterly Planning Note — Legacy Price Increase

Heads of department: the uplift for legacy Corvalt subscribers is confirmed for next quarter. Scope: all pre-2021 plans. Increase: 7%, flat. Comms go out four weeks prior; support scripts are drafted. Expect elevated ticket volume in month one. Retention offers are approved for top-tier accounts only. No exceptions without sign-off from the pricing committee. Context on the wider plan is noted confidentially below.

board note of fahop-yahop: Ulaathax Group is in early talks to buy Joriusek Partners for about $422.0 million. The Istys launch date is October 18, and nothing goes to the press before then. Legal wants the Silathix Logistics term sheet countersigned before June 11.